February 26, 2007 at 9:16 pm · Filed under Mount Bachelor
Finally! After a nearly 4 week dry spell we are getting some new snow. It snowed consistently all week and Bachelor was averaging around 4-5 inches a day. Alot of it is wind packed, but down in the trees is really quite good. The crowds showed up over the weekend, but fresh lines could still be had out past Northwest Express. Expect a great week of crowdless skiing as the storms continue to roll through. Snow is expected daily through next weekend.

February 12, 2007 at 9:36 pm · Filed under Horse Ridge
Activity: Trail Run
Weather: 46 partly cloudy
Trail conditions: fair to good
All the snow and ice is gone but this weekends rain has left a little mud behind. Most of the trail below fenceline is dry and in good condition. Above fenceline expect varying amounts of mud. Rideable, but not good for running past fenceline. The Ridge dries out fast, so a few more warm dry days should improve conditions up high.
